NEW DELHI: England captain Jos Buttler won the toss and chose to bat against Pakistan in the 44th match of the ICC Cricket World Cup 2023 at the Eden Gardens in Kolkata on Saturday.

England are unchanged, while Pakistan replaced Hasan Ali with Shadab Khan in their playing XI.

After winning the toss, Buttler said, "We gonna bat first. Looks a good wicket, looks a bit dry and we want to make first use of it. We are going with the same team today. We are playing well together and would look to justice to ourselves. (On David Willey) Emotional day for him, he has been great for us. So, we talked about trying to enjoy it and take it all in."


After losing the toss, Pakistan captain Babar Azam said, "We wanted to bat first, but toss is not in our hands. We have good bowlers and we would look to bowl them out cheaply. We have one change - Hasan Ali is not playing and Shadab Khan comes in his place."

England XI: Jonny Bairstow, Dawid Malan, Joe Root, Ben Stokes, Harry Brook, Jos Buttler(w/c), Moeen Ali, Chris Woakes, David Willey, Gus Atkinson, Adil Rashid

Pakistan XI: Abdullah Shafique, Fakhar Zaman, Babar Azam(c), Mohammad Rizwan(w), Saud Shakeel, Iftikhar Ahmed, Agha Salman, Shadab Khan, Shaheen Afridi, Mohammad Wasim Jr, Haris Rauf
